            Yeah it's half the battle with the dirt cheap end. Some of the games I've bought as cheap ones in Cex, I've looked at dozens of them and waited literally years to find a nice one. Often they were nice games when they were traded in, but gradually get battered about by kids smacking the cases round and putting their jam-covered fingers all over the manual. I reckon some Wii games I must have looked at 50+ copies by now.

            All I can say is you have to keep going over and over as often as possible and grab them just as they come in. Sometimes I even just grab stuff from the trade-in pile on the counter before it's had a chance to be put on the shelves. It's a bit cheeky but they don't seem to really mind.

            In the case of that Call of Duty game, there's at least a dozen brand new sealed ones on eBay in any case - goes for about £20-odd which I think is way above what it's worth to be honest.

              I think the problem with a lot of ultra common stuff is that CeX is treated as a de facto rental place by a lot of kids. So the same stuff is getting bought and traded again and again by people who aren’t really looking after it as they’re planning to quickly trade it back.
